"It's nothing-just some old things I don't need anymore." He offered me a bowl of congee. "I remembered you liked this chicken congee from that little shop. I went out of my way to get it for you." I looked down at the steaming bowl in his hands, a sudden tickle in my nose threatening to betray the flood of memories rushing back-fifteen years of shared moments, laughter, and tears. Letting go of all that wasn't going to be simple.

We had truly been together, truly loved each other once. But the truth remained-our love had soured, twisted into something unrecognizable. I didn't take the congee. "Thanks, but I don't need it anymore." Liam's eyes widened in surprise. "You don't like it now?" It wasn't about liking it anymore; it was that I no longer needed it from him. "No, I'm just tired of it. Just throw it away." Under his puzzled gaze, I tossed the bowl into the dumpster nearby. "You don't have to buy me anything anymore. I can manage on my own." He stared at me, confusion washing over his face like a wave.

I wanted him to understand what was wrong, but instead, he gave a small smile and stepped closer. "That's good. I'm glad you can take care of yourself now." Then he pulled me into a hug. "If I'm ever not around, promise me you'll eat well and look after yourself." In that moment, my heart felt like it was being ripped apart. Goodbyes always came too quickly-like a cruel rehearsal for the real farewell. The warmth I once found in his embrace had vanished, leaving behind only cold emptiness. But the hug was brief.

He grabbed his phone and hurried away, rushing off to someone else just as he used to rush to me. I refused to be part of this painful charade any longer. During the final month of college, everyone was caught up in farewells. Invitations flooded in for all kinds of gatherings, big and small. One night, someone rented out Lakeview Villa for a party open to all grades. I went with Sophia-it was our last chance to spend time together before graduation. I hadn't expected to see Chloe there. She arrived with Liam, his hand gently holding hers as they walked through the villa's grand entrance.

Sophia crossed her arms, clearly irritated. "If you didn't know them, you'd think they were a couple. How can you stand this?" I looked away, trying to avoid the tension. "I don't want to fight. Yelling and crying won't change anything." "I'm lucky enough to just walk away. I'd rather focus on planning my own future." She gave me a thumbs-up. "That's the spirit! Come on, let's go have some fun." Fifteen years of love-releasing it wasn't easy. My brave face was just a mask.

Crowds always made me uncomfortable, so I slipped away to the backyard alone, lying down on the cool grass to clear my mind. Suddenly, Chloe found me. "Senior, you're really living the good life, huh?" I ignored her, unwilling to waste my breath. Her anger flared at my silence. "You don't know, do you? Liam isn't going abroad anymore." "He said he couldn't bear to leave me. He's staying for me. And you? You'll have to go alone." I knew she was looking for a fight. "Congratulations." "You're not even mad? What's your game?" I removed my eye mask and stood up. "Mad about what?

A guy who doesn't love me anymore? You can have him." Chloe stared at me, stunned. "You don't love Liam anymore? Then why won't you let him go?" "If you don't love him, be honest with him. I didn't realize you were so manipulative-leading him on even when your heart isn't in it." I didn't deny it. I was hesitant, maybe a little spiteful. When I discovered the truth, I could have screamed or fought him, but I knew it wasn't worth it. Someone who had fallen out of love wasn't worth the pain. "I'll just say this: you haven't truly captured his heart yet.

If you had, he would have told me the truth by now." That struck a nerve. Chloe froze. Deep down, she knew that after all their time together, Liam still carried me in his heart. "Fine. Then I'll make sure Liam erases you from his heart completely." Suddenly, Chloe grabbed my hand and slapped her own face with it. I yanked my hand back immediately. "What are you doing? If you want to lose your mind, do it somewhere else!" She smiled faintly. "Senior, from now on, Liam's heart belongs only to me." Then, without warning, she screamed and fell backward into the pool. "Help!

Help!" "Senior, I know I was wrong! I really do! I..." Her cries echoed through the backyard, drawing everyone's attention. They found me standing alone beside the pool, holding a ribbon that had slipped from Chloe's hair. "Emma! What are you doing? Why did you push Chloe into the pool?"
